18 votos

Cortocircuito en el interior de la CPU durante el funcionamiento

He recibido dos placas de uno de nuestros clientes que tienen el mismo defecto. Se trata de un cortocircuito entre V CC y GND. Pude rastrear este cortocircuito hasta el MCU (que es un LPC1114 de NXP ) con una cámara térmica. Estas placas estuvieron funcionando bastante tiempo en las instalaciones del cliente, hasta que se produjo el cortocircuito.

En las imágenes de abajo puedes ver dos MCUs diferentes. Uno que todavía está soldado en la PCB y otro que fue retirado de la PCB y suministrado con V CC /GND.

Enter image description here

Enter image description here

Edición1: En ambas imágenes, el Pin1 de la CPU está en la esquina superior derecha (vista TOP de la MCU).

Mis preguntas para usted:

  • ¿Alguien ha experimentado alguna vez un cortocircuito interno en la MCU?
  • ¿Cuál podría ser la causa de ese cortocircuito interno en la MCU? (Se aceptan conjeturas :-)
  • ¿Es posible que se produzca un cortocircuito de este tipo cuando hay temperaturas demasiado elevadas?

Edit2: Pinout de la MCU MCU pinout

29voto

Spehro Pefhany Puntos 90994

La causa típica sería algún transitorio eléctrico desde el exterior acoplado a un pin de E/S, que causa un latch-up y destrucción a través de la fuente de alimentación. Un diseño adecuado de los circuitos de protección suele evitarlo en situaciones en las que no caiga un rayo.

Los transitorios de la fuente de alimentación también podrían causarlo, sólo unos pocos voltios podrían ser suficientes, pero normalmente eso no ocurre.

También podría producirse una inversión momentánea de la tensión de alimentación.

13voto

Paul Puntos 101

Estoy de acuerdo con otras respuestas en que una sobretensión externa en el pin de E/S es una causa probable, aunque una sobretensión externa en V DD pin también es una posible causa.

Para arreglar el circuito, sería útil saber qué pin de E/S recibió el transitorio. A veces esto se puede determinar midiendo los diodos de protección internos del chip utilizando el modo diodo del multímetro:

  1. Mida con el cable negro del V DD y el cable rojo en cada pin de E/S. Toma nota de las lecturas.
  2. Mide con el cable rojo en la patilla GND y el cable negro en cada patilla E/S. Anote las lecturas.

Para un chip totalmente funcional, los valores esperados serían de 0,6 V en cada patilla. A menudo, una patilla de E/S dañada mostrará una tensión directa del diodo infinita o nula, ya que el diodo de protección se ha quemado antes de que se dañaran otras partes del chip.

9voto

jemz Puntos 106

Que yo sepa, sí, pertenece a un transeúnte de fuera. Un pin de E/S o V DD con una escasa corriente transitoria y altas cargas de las patillas de E/S cortocircuitarán las CPU.

  • En el mejor de los casos, a veces, es un diodo interno o un pin enclavado (por defecto) en la salida el que induce el cortocircuito.
  • Puede permanecer en cortocircuito durante un tiempo indeterminado hasta que el diodo o MOSFET se queme por completo (dependiendo de su corriente máxima de funcionamiento).
  • Si la fuente de alimentación a la que está conectada la placa es una fuente de tensión lineal, o un SMPS con bombas de corriente escasas (SMPS de conmutación de baja frecuencia o condensador de conmutación defectuoso o ambos), el efecto de los pines de E/S bloqueados puede extenderse a las partes internas de la CPU y no recuperarse nunca.
  • Si la CPU tiene un bajo consumo de corriente aunque esté en cortocircuito puede ser un componente externo cableado a un interrumpir clavija que detiene la CPU desde el inicio en un estado de bucle indefinido
  • Puede haber varios V DD a las condiciones del terreno para investigar.

Aquí tienes algunas ideas más:

  • Intenta usar una fuente de voltaje/corriente de precisión para alimentar la secuencia y comprueba en el osciloscopio si hay pines bloqueados mientras arranca.
  • Intente identificar los pines de E/S que pueden ser colectores abiertos y tomar medidas. Si se alimenta alto mientras está enganchado bajo, puedes invertir temporalmente el voltaje del pin y la secuencia de arranque puede saltar por encima del drenaje de corriente y arranque

i-Ciencias.com

I-Ciencias es una comunidad de estudiantes y amantes de la ciencia en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X